Abstract

Optical code-division multiple-access technology is the key factor affecting the performance of optical steganography transmission system. The OCDMA technology based on equivalent phase-shifted encoder/decoder with low reflectivity for is presented in this paper, the performance of optical steganography transmission system is investigated with different input spectral width. The curves of the relationship between performance of steganography channel and its spectral width are obtained. From the analysis of simulation result, we can see when the spectral width meet some condition, “optimum” BER performance can be obtained, namely, a fixed value with the steganography pulse spectral width, will result in a better system performance.
